A composition in seven parts for 8 soundbodies (2 loudspeakers, 2 transducers hanging on metal sheets, 1 transducer on a snare drum, 2 bass shakers mounted under a metal pan filled with water, 1 bass speaker). Source material are recordings of water from Malta valley made in 2021 in Carinthia/Austria. The work is connected to the project MONOLITH with the artists Georg Planer, Peter Paszkiewicz, Josef Baier who did stone sculptures in a quarry in the same region and also geologist Urs Kloetzli who researched the nature of the stone and the landscape.
The project Monolith was founded by the sculptors Georg Planer and Peter Paszkiewicz. In 2021 an intermedial cooperation between stone sculpture, experimental music, rock science and film took place around a quarry in the Malta Valley in Carinthia/Austria. Katharina Klement created a composition for 8 sound bodies, the sound material for this was exclusively water recordings from this Valley. The catalogue integrates texts, photos, weblinks to sound and film, and the CD.
